The Traverso Family's Early Years in Cannes
Giovanni Traverso: The Founding Father
Giovanni Traverso, the patriarch of the family, arrived in Cannes in the early 1900s, drawn by the city's burgeoning beauty and the promise of a new life. His early photographic endeavors focused on capturing the picturesque landscapes and charming architecture of the then-developing resort town. His unique style, characterized by a keen eye for detail and a masterful use of light and shadow, quickly gained recognition. He favored a natural, almost documentary style, showcasing the everyday lives of the Cannes residents against the backdrop of the stunning Riviera coastline.
- Notable early works: Le Marché Forville, capturing the vibrant energy of the local market; Vue de la Croisette, showcasing the nascent elegance of the iconic promenade; Les Bateliers de Cannes, a series depicting the local fishermen and their boats.
- Preferred photographic techniques: Giovanni was a master of black and white photography, employing meticulous darkroom techniques to achieve rich tones and unparalleled detail. He was known for his use of natural light and his ability to capture candid moments.
Expanding the Legacy: The Second Generation
Giovanni's children inherited his passion and skill, expanding the family's photographic business and adapting to the evolving landscape of photography. They embraced new technologies, transitioning from traditional darkroom processes to early forms of color photography, while maintaining the family's commitment to capturing the essence of Cannes. This generation saw a diversification of subject matter, moving beyond landscapes to encompass portraiture and event photography.
- Expanding the business: They opened a prominent studio in the heart of Cannes, attracting clientele from across the region and beyond.
- Notable achievements: The second generation won several prestigious awards for their photographic work, including recognition for their contributions to documenting the cultural heritage of the region. Their work was featured in various publications and exhibitions.
Capturing the Glamour: The Traverso Family and the Cannes Film Festival
Behind-the-Scenes Access and Iconic Images
The Traverso family's unique access to the Cannes Film Festival allowed them to capture iconic moments and portraits of legendary actors and actresses. Their close relationships with festival organizers and film personalities provided unparalleled opportunities for behind-the-scenes photography, resulting in a collection of intimate and memorable images. These photographs offer a rare glimpse into the glamour and excitement of the world's most prestigious film event.
- Iconic Images: Photographs featuring legends like Marlon Brando, Brigitte Bardot, and Alfred Hitchcock, immortalizing their presence at the festival.
- Relationships with film personalities: The Traverso family's reputation for discretion and professionalism allowed them to build strong relationships with many prominent figures, leading to exclusive photographic opportunities.
Documenting the Evolution of the Festival
The Traverso family's photographs chronicle the Cannes Film Festival's remarkable growth and transformation over decades. Their work provides a visual narrative of the festival's evolution, reflecting the changing styles, trends, and atmosphere of the event. From the early days of simpler ceremonies to the modern-day spectacle, their images capture the festival's enduring legacy.
- Evolution of photography: The Traverso family's work showcases the evolution of photographic technology itself, from early black and white film to sophisticated color photography.
- Different eras: Their photographs document different eras of the festival, from the more restrained elegance of the early years to the vibrant, international flair of the modern festival.
Beyond the Festival: The Everyday Life of Cannes through the Traverso Lens
Capturing the Essence of Cannes
Beyond the glamour of the film festival, the Traverso family meticulously captured the everyday life of Cannes. Their photographs portray the city's landscapes, architecture, people, and unique atmosphere, creating a detailed and intimate portrait of the city's character. They documented local markets, bustling streets, seaside activities, and the lives of ordinary citizens, presenting a complete picture of Cannes that extends beyond the red carpet.
- Diverse subjects: Their work includes images of local fishermen, market vendors, children playing on the beach, and the everyday routines of Cannes residents.
- Specific projects: They were involved in several projects documenting local communities and events.
Preserving a Cultural Heritage
The Traverso family's photographs play a crucial role in preserving the cultural heritage of Cannes. Their extensive archive offers invaluable historical and artistic documentation of the city's transformation over a century. Efforts are underway to archive and exhibit their work, ensuring that future generations can appreciate the legacy of this remarkable photographic dynasty.
- Exhibitions and publications: Their work has been showcased in numerous exhibitions and publications, both nationally and internationally.
- Digital archives: A growing digital archive is being created to ensure that these photographs are accessible to a wider audience.
